Why Choose Stock Investments?
Investing in stocks offers a pathway to wealth creation that is unparalleled by other financial vehicles. By owning shares of companies, you participate in their growth and success. Here are some key advantages of stock investments:
- Wealth Growth: Stocks have historically outperformed other asset classes, delivering long-term value.
- Portfolio Diversification: Equities provide a means to diversify your financial portfolio, reducing risk.
- Passive Income: Dividends from certain stocks generate a steady income stream.
- Ownership Stakes: When you buy shares, you own a piece of the company, with potential for voting rights and dividends.
How to Get Started in Stock Investments
1. Define Your Financial Goals
Begin by identifying your objectives. Are you looking for long-term growth, steady income, or short-term gains? Your goals will dictate the type of stocks you should consider.
2. Educate Yourself on Market Basics
Understanding key terms and concepts is crucial. Familiarize yourself with:
- Stock Exchanges: Platforms like NYSE and NASDAQ.
- Indices: Benchmarks such as S&P 500, Dow Jones, and Nasdaq Composite.
- Stock Categories: Growth stocks, dividend stocks, blue-chip stocks, etc.
3. Choose a Brokerage
Selecting the right brokerage is essential for seamless trading. Evaluate brokers based on their:
- Fee Structures: Look for low or no commission fees.
- Trading Platforms: Ensure the interface is user-friendly and provides robust tools.
- Research Resources: Access to financial analysis and news.
4. Build a Diversified Portfolio
Diversification reduces risk. Consider balancing your portfolio with:
- Large-Cap Stocks: Stable and less volatile.
- Small-Cap Stocks: Potential for high growth.
- International Stocks: Broaden exposure to global markets.
5. Keep an Eye on Market Trends
Stay updated on:
- Economic indicators (GDP, unemployment rates).
- Corporate earnings reports.
- Geopolitical events that may influence markets.
Top Stock Picking Strategies
1. Value Investing
Value investors seek stocks trading below their intrinsic value. This strategy involves:
- Analyzing Financial Statements: Look for companies with strong fundamentals.
- Low Price-to-Earnings Ratios (P/E): Indicates undervaluation.
- High Dividend Yields: Suggests stable cash flow.
